1. Leonardo DiCaprio Foundation
Remember Leo’s Oscars acceptance speech? He said, “Climate change is real, it is happening right now. It is the most urgent threat facing our entire species, and we need to work collectively together and stop procrastinating.”
Yes, Leonardo DiCaprio has shown his concerns in environment issues for a long time. In 1998, he founded Leonardo DiCaprio Foundation (LDF). It is no surprise that this charity foundation is dedicated to the long-term health and wellbeing of all Earth’s inhabitants.
The LDF has four major programs: protecting biodiversity, oceans conservation, wild land conservation, and of course, climate change. Since it was founded, LDF managed to raised and granted $45 million to 65 organizations.
